男人摸女人的胸视频,91精品国产91久久久久久最新,黄色视频性爱免费看,黄瓜视频在线观看,国产小视频国产精品,成人福利国产一区二区,国产高清精品自拍91亚洲,国产91一区二区

加急見刊

試析遠(yuǎn)程教育網(wǎng)絡(luò)認(rèn)證考試系統(tǒng)的結(jié)構(gòu)設(shè)計(jì)與功能實(shí)現(xiàn)

孫惠生

: 論文關(guān)鍵詞;考生系統(tǒng)8/S模式認(rèn)證方法安全策略

論文摘要:本文在分析在線認(rèn)證和考評(píng)系統(tǒng)的系統(tǒng)需求和相關(guān)理論基礎(chǔ)上,著重介紹基于B/S結(jié)構(gòu)網(wǎng)絡(luò)認(rèn)證考試系統(tǒng)的結(jié)構(gòu)特點(diǎn)、系統(tǒng)組成、用戶認(rèn)證方法和系統(tǒng)安全策略。

近年來,隨著互聯(lián)網(wǎng)和軟件技術(shù)不斷發(fā)展,現(xiàn)代化交互式遠(yuǎn)程教育技術(shù)在各個(gè)高校中也迅速?gòu)V泛發(fā)展開來,目前很多高校都已開始利用多媒體互聯(lián)網(wǎng)絡(luò)技術(shù)進(jìn)行遠(yuǎn)程教育授課,在線的認(rèn)證和考評(píng)也成為遠(yuǎn)程教育重要組成部分。通過自動(dòng)化在線考試系統(tǒng)進(jìn)行考試,可以在一定程度上減輕教師在考試環(huán)節(jié)的勞動(dòng)強(qiáng)度,讓任課教師擺脫人工出卷、評(píng)卷、上成績(jī)、分析考試結(jié)果等繁瑣的工作,同時(shí)可以利用考試系統(tǒng)結(jié)合多媒體視訊技術(shù)來增加考試監(jiān)控,提高考試的效度和信度。

1、系統(tǒng)的體系結(jié)構(gòu)

網(wǎng)絡(luò)認(rèn)證考試系統(tǒng)是B/S模式的系統(tǒng)。使用B/S模式編寫的應(yīng)用程序主要是客戶端通過IE、firefox等客戶端瀏覽程序向系統(tǒng)的服務(wù)器端發(fā)出數(shù)據(jù)訪問請(qǐng)求,服務(wù)器收到客戶端發(fā)來的請(qǐng)求后調(diào)用相應(yīng)的CGI程序。將訪問請(qǐng)求翻譯為相應(yīng)的SQL語(yǔ)句,并執(zhí)行。SQL語(yǔ)句的訪問請(qǐng)求會(huì)提交給數(shù)據(jù)庫(kù)服務(wù)器,數(shù)據(jù)庫(kù)服務(wù)器根據(jù)請(qǐng)求驗(yàn)證其是否合法,如果合法,則執(zhí)行相應(yīng)的數(shù)據(jù)操作,并將操作得到的結(jié)果返回給CGI程序,CGI程序得到結(jié)果后,將其轉(zhuǎn)化為HTML語(yǔ)言,并在用戶的瀏覽器上顯示得到的數(shù)據(jù)結(jié)果,否則將返回給客戶端一個(gè)顯示錯(cuò)誤信息。在B/S模式中,用戶的電腦中只需要配備標(biāo)準(zhǔn)的瀏覽器,而其業(yè)務(wù)和數(shù)據(jù)的處理都是由web服務(wù)器和數(shù)據(jù)庫(kù)服務(wù)器來完成的。

使用B/S結(jié)構(gòu)編寫的網(wǎng)絡(luò)認(rèn)證考試系統(tǒng)采用了包含用戶層,業(yè)務(wù)邏輯層,數(shù)據(jù)層三層的體系結(jié)構(gòu)。用戶層負(fù)責(zé)處理數(shù)據(jù)的輸入輸出;業(yè)務(wù)邏輯層負(fù)責(zé)建立數(shù)據(jù)庫(kù)連接,并負(fù)責(zé)將檢索到的數(shù)據(jù)結(jié)果送回到客戶端;數(shù)據(jù)層負(fù)責(zé)的數(shù)據(jù)存儲(chǔ)和檢索。

2、系統(tǒng)的功能設(shè)計(jì)

在遠(yuǎn)程教育考核認(rèn)證系統(tǒng)中共有3種用戶,即教師、系統(tǒng)管理員和應(yīng)試考生。因此,在系統(tǒng)中,我們根據(jù)這3種用戶的角色來劃分功能,根據(jù)各自的功能講系統(tǒng)劃分成3個(gè)不同的模塊:教師操作模塊、系統(tǒng)管理員操作模塊和應(yīng)試考生操作模塊。

根據(jù)實(shí)際的使用需要,還應(yīng)將教師細(xì)分為普通教師和教學(xué)管理組織者,普通教師就是一般的任課教師,教學(xué)管理組織者一般是教研室主任或教務(wù)科長(zhǎng),他們主要完成系統(tǒng)中相關(guān)課程的管理工作,包括試題的出題規(guī)則、試卷的審核等。

教師操作模塊根據(jù)教師的角色不同也主要分為下面兩類功能:教學(xué)管理組織者主要完成對(duì)課程信息、課程知識(shí)點(diǎn)等科目信息的管理,并通過考試認(rèn)證系統(tǒng)分配管理監(jiān)考的教師和考生,同時(shí)也要監(jiān)管任課教師對(duì)于試卷方面的工作,包括對(duì)組卷方案的審核和管理、對(duì)于試卷的審核等。普通任課教師主要負(fù)責(zé)制定試卷的組卷方案,完成試題自動(dòng)生成、錄入、修改等,考試完成后進(jìn)行成績(jī)的查詢、統(tǒng)計(jì)、分析和管理。

系統(tǒng)管理員操作模塊主要讓管理員通過其完成對(duì)系統(tǒng)參數(shù)、初始信息設(shè)置等,并管理系統(tǒng)給中的用戶。給用戶分配相應(yīng)額權(quán)限。同時(shí)還可以管理、發(fā)布與考試、成績(jī)等相關(guān)的信息等。

考生模塊主要面向考生提供在線考試、成績(jī)查詢和信息瀏覽功能。考生可通過信息瀏覽發(fā)布系統(tǒng)查詢最新考試動(dòng)態(tài),并根據(jù)課程安排選擇在讀課程進(jìn)行在線考試,考試完成后,可根據(jù)需要對(duì)評(píng)定完的考試成績(jī)進(jìn)行查詢。

3、用戶身份的驗(yàn)證方法

在前面我們提到,在整個(gè)考試系統(tǒng)中共有3類用戶,即教師、考生、管理員,系統(tǒng)采用下面方法對(duì)登錄用戶進(jìn)行類別區(qū)分和權(quán)限分配。

教師、考生和管理員登錄系統(tǒng)時(shí),系統(tǒng)首先根據(jù)用戶輸入用戶名和密碼進(jìn)行身份驗(yàn)證,來判斷用戶的權(quán)限。因?yàn)樵谙到y(tǒng)中教師、考生和管理員的權(quán)限大不相同,所以在驗(yàn)證時(shí)候要采用不同驗(yàn)證的方式。通常在系統(tǒng)中采用Session對(duì)象來具體代表不同系統(tǒng)反饋信息,具體參數(shù)配置如下表所示: 根據(jù)上面的表格我們可以判斷,當(dāng)Session變量值是B、D、F時(shí)是分別代表的是合法的考生、系統(tǒng)管理員、教師用戶,在其他情況下的訪問都屬于非法的,在非法訪問中根據(jù)情況不同,系統(tǒng)又給出3種不同的反饋信息,如Session值為A,則認(rèn)為該用戶通過系統(tǒng)的登錄驗(yàn)證而直接訪問后面有權(quán)限限制的操作頁(yè)面;如Session值為c,系統(tǒng)會(huì)提示用戶輸入了無(wú)效的用戶名或密碼,出現(xiàn)以上情況,系統(tǒng)都給出相應(yīng)的用戶提示。

4、考試安全性策略

考生參加在線考試的過程中,我們要考慮到操作的安全性。有些操作可能是考生的誤操作,但有些操作可能是惡意的。因?yàn)檎麄€(gè)考試都要在計(jì)算機(jī)上進(jìn)行,這樣考生就可以利用u盤、移動(dòng)硬盤的外部存儲(chǔ)設(shè)備或計(jì)算機(jī)本身的硬盤存儲(chǔ)器,來存放考試的相關(guān)資料,然后通過復(fù)制、屏幕硬拷貝等方法復(fù)制試題數(shù)據(jù),從而獲取試題資料。所以在構(gòu)建網(wǎng)絡(luò)考試系統(tǒng)時(shí)要考慮系統(tǒng)安全性問題,通常需要對(duì)一些系統(tǒng)中快捷鍵、鼠標(biāo)鍵、菜單命令通過程序進(jìn)行屏蔽處理,來防止考生作弊。

屏蔽快捷鍵和菜單命令方法雖并不能從技術(shù)上完全杜絕考生作弊行為,但也可以在一定程度上防止考生直接從相關(guān)考試資料和文檔中復(fù)制答案。

除考試過程中對(duì)于考生操作安全性策略之外,在線考試系統(tǒng)本身的題庫(kù)、試卷、成績(jī)的數(shù)據(jù)安全性也必需要加以考慮,在這里我們采用了ND5加密技術(shù),來保證系統(tǒng)用戶的安全性,并且編寫了數(shù)據(jù)檢索函數(shù),來解決SQL注入問題,確保系統(tǒng)數(shù)據(jù)安全性

網(wǎng)絡(luò)在線考試系統(tǒng)平臺(tái)的建立和應(yīng)用可以將繁瑣考試及閱讀變得非常簡(jiǎn)捷,從而有效提高遠(yuǎn)程教育教學(xué)和考核效率。目前我們?cè)诰€考評(píng)系統(tǒng)已經(jīng)在我院計(jì)算機(jī)類和其他類別的客觀性試題考試當(dāng)中進(jìn)行了測(cè)試和應(yīng)用,效果良好。我們還將在今后應(yīng)用和測(cè)試中不斷修改和完善。

[1]康莉,計(jì)算機(jī)考試系統(tǒng)的設(shè)計(jì)于是先,計(jì)算機(jī)教育,2006(4)

[2]徐魯雄,黃雛通,網(wǎng)絡(luò)考試系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n),計(jì)算機(jī)教育,2006(9)

[3]王亞利,雷勇,張來順,網(wǎng)絡(luò)考試系統(tǒng)安全性問題的探討及解決方案,電腦開發(fā)與應(yīng)用,2007(12)

[4]于海鵬,李莉,基于WEB的在線考試系統(tǒng)設(shè)計(jì)實(shí)現(xiàn),福建電腦,2007(12)

下載